Lionhead's Milo Canceled Again?

by Matthew Kato on Sep 23, 2010 at 04:13 AM

There have been lots of stories this year regarding the whereabouts of Lionhead's Kinect project Milo, and the lastest rumor once again says that the project has been canceled.

A report from Eurogamer states that work on the Kinect title has been stopped, and 19 "contractors" related to Milo were let go, according to a close source. Neither Microsoft nor Lionhead have offered a substantive comment on the situation.

The story also says that Lionhead will incorporate the Milo tech in a Fable-themed Kinect title at some point.

After not appearing at this year's E3, there were reports that Milo had been canceled, but this was soon refuted by Microsoft, who stated that the project was still on, but simply wouldn't be out in 2010. Molyneux himself backed this up with a demo at the TEDGlobal 2010 conference in July.

If the pattern holds, this latest Milo obituary will be followed by another demo, but your guess is as good as ours as to whether Milo is still around.
